They say “Laugh and eh whole world laughs with you...” Well, it was anything but a laughing matter when former stand-up comic and Saturday Night Live Writer Al Franken Joined the Senate committee hearings into the Halliburton/KKR inquiry where the company had taken the position that it’s “binding arbitration” contract with employees was done for the good of the employees. Halliburton/KKR maintained that the clause was to provide employees with an expedited means of addressing their grievances, and further suggested that employees who were raped did better with private arbitration than they would in court.

Though not a lawyer, Senator Franken has the opportunity to examine witnesses at the hearing, and he makes surprisingly good use of his authority

No, Al wasn't very funny. But then, the gang rape of Jamie Leigh Jones wasn't very funny either. Nor was her being held captive in a shipping container under armed guard. Nor is her 4 years of fighting Halliburton's refusal to face the consequences in court. There just isn't much funny about any of this. In fact, the whole thing is pretty sick.
